Bachelor of Business Administration (BBA)
Tuition Rates – 2026 – 2027
| Michigan Resident: | |
| Lower Division Tuition (0-54 credits towards program) | $9,766 per Semester or $19,532 for Academic Year based on full-time enrollment |
| Upper Division Tuition (55+ credits towards program) | $12,371 per Semester or $24,742 for Academic Year based on full-time enrollment |
| Non-Resident: | |
| Lower Division Tuition (0-54 credits towards program) | $33,865 per Semester or $67,730 for Academic Year based on full-time enrollment |
| Upper Division Tuition (55+ credits towards program) | $37,918 per Semester or $75,836 for Academic Year based on full-time enrollment |
Full time enrollment is 12-18 credits per semester.

The 2026 – 2027 tuition rates were approved by the University of Michigan Board of Regents in June 2026. The 2027 – 2028 tuition rates and cost of attendance budget will be available July 2027.
All registered students will be charged $246.89 for the mandatory registration fees per term. Class fees are dependent on the registered classes. For information on current tuition and fee rates, please visit the Office of the Registrar website.

Financial Aid Information
Financial Aid awarding for undergraduate BBA students is managed through the main campus University of Michigan Office of Financial Aid. This included, federal aid (such as Pell Grant, work study, and direct loans) , institutional aid (such as the Go Blue Guarantee and University of Michigan Grant), and private or 3rd party scholarships/loans.
